CONFRONTATION
Confrontation is a piece about the visceral self hatred part of recovery. About the inevitable, overwhelming feelings of shame and guilt that come with trying to be a better person. It isn't easy or comfortable to take accountability of your flaws. It can come with a desire to purge all the memories of hurting others, whether intentionally or not, to forget the moments you replay in your head at night thinking of how you could've done better. You want those feelings out of your body. Self reflection isn't about blaming yourself or living in the past, but those who ignore history are doomed to repeat it.
